Monument of the African Renaissance

Visiting the Monument of the African Renaissance was quite interesting, and it offers a stunning view over the city of Dakar. The monument is truly impressive, and the best part is that it’s easy to access — no major detours needed. An hour here is more than enough to take in the sights and appreciate its grandeur. Ngor Island

If you're in Dakar, make sure to spend a day or even just part of a day on Ngor Island, just a short boat ride away. The round-trip boat fare is only 1000 CFA per person. The beach on the Dakar side is beautiful, with colorful local boats floating peacefully, and across the way, you can see Ngor Island. As the saying goes, "land looks better from the sea", and it’s true! But once you get to Ngor, you'll realize that Dakar itself is beautiful too. On Ngor, there are no cars, and that's part of its charm: the calm, the peacefulness. Here, life slows down. There are plenty of little bars and restaurants with terraces and loungers where you can soak up the country’s amazing weather, especially during the dry season. Wander around the island, explore the local artisan shops, and don't forget to enjoy some fresh fish of the day, which is a real treat! For the more active types, there are world-class surfing spots. Ngor is a true surf paradise, with famous waves like Ngor Left and Ngor Right. If you don’t have your own gear, don’t worry, you can easily rent everything you need right on the island. What I really loved about Ngor is how quiet it still is, with relatively few people around, making the experience even more enjoyable. Overall, spending a day on Ngor is a great way to start or end your trip around Senegal. I highly recommend it!
